Hallo bianca,
2015-03-30T05:57:07
biancaKönntest du das bitte nochmal checken indem du das obere Script auch nochmal laufen lässt, bevor du ein Update machst?
Jetzt habe ich gerade nochmals alle drei Varianten ausgeführt.
msg #180400: Keine Rückmeldung. Auch keine Fehlermeldung; kein Wunder, denn hier wird
XML::Parser ja gar nicht verwendet.
msg #180427: Rückmeldung wie gehabt
Version SOAP::Lite: 0.715
Version XML::Parser: 2.41
Version IO::Socket::SSL: 1.76
msg #180439: Rückmeldung wie gehabt aber diesmal
ohne Fehlermeldung.
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
Version SOAP::Lite: 0.715
Version XML::Parser: 2.41
Version IO::Socket::SSL: 1.76
DEBUG: .../IO/Socket/SSL.pm:1645: new ctx 41060128
DEBUG: .../IO/Socket/SSL.pm:363: socket not yet connected
DEBUG: .../IO/Socket/SSL.pm:365: socket connected
DEBUG: .../IO/Socket/SSL.pm:383: ssl handshake not started
DEBUG: .../IO/Socket/SSL.pm:433: set socket to non-blocking to enforce timeout=180
DEBUG: .../IO/Socket/SSL.pm:446: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:456: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:466: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:486: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:446: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:456: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:466: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:486: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:1633: ok=1 cert=37827088
DEBUG: .../IO/Socket/SSL.pm:1633: ok=1 cert=57287744
DEBUG: .../IO/Socket/SSL.pm:1633: ok=1 cert=57287920
DEBUG: .../IO/Socket/SSL.pm:1633: ok=1 cert=57287392
DEBUG: .../IO/Socket/SSL.pm:1193: scheme=www cert=57287392
DEBUG: .../IO/Socket/SSL.pm:1202: identity=ssl.ibanrechner.de cn=ssl.ibanrechner.de alt=2 ssl.ibanrechner.de 2 bak1.iban-bic.com 2 sepatools.eu
DEBUG: .../IO/Socket/SSL.pm:446: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:456: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:466: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:486: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:446: Net::SSLeay::connect -> 1
DEBUG: .../IO/Socket/SSL.pm:501: ssl handshake done
DEBUG: .../IO/Socket/SSL.pm:1682: free ctx 41060128 open=41060128
DEBUG: .../IO/Socket/SSL.pm:1687: free ctx 41060128 callback
DEBUG: .../IO/Socket/SSL.pm:1690: OK free ctx 41060128
Ich habe es mehrmals hintereinander ausgeführt.
Das scheint mir nun darauf hinzudeuten, dass es an der Datenquelle liegt; manchmal kommt XML mit junk, manchmal ohne. Ich bin in das Ganze nicht eingestiegen. Kannst Du den junk nicht einfach ignorieren, d.h. sind die übrigen Daten nicht brauchbar?
Grüße
payx
PS: Jetzt habe ich mal die drei Module upgedated. Jetzt kommt bei
msg #180439: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
Version SOAP::Lite: 1.14
Version XML::Parser: 2.44
Version IO::Socket::SSL: 2.012
DEBUG: .../IO/Socket/SSL.pm:2602: new ctx 49599632
DEBUG: .../IO/Socket/SSL.pm:542: socket not yet connected
DEBUG: .../IO/Socket/SSL.pm:544: socket connected
DEBUG: .../IO/Socket/SSL.pm:566: ssl handshake not started
DEBUG: .../IO/Socket/SSL.pm:599: using SNI with hostname ssl.ibanrechner.de
DEBUG: .../IO/Socket/SSL.pm:653: set socket to non-blocking to enforce timeout=180
DEBUG: .../IO/Socket/SSL.pm:667: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:677: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:687: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:707: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:667: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:677: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:687: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:707: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:2458: ok=1 cert=57365984
DEBUG: .../IO/Socket/SSL.pm:2458: ok=1 cert=58095568
DEBUG: .../IO/Socket/SSL.pm:2458: ok=1 cert=58095744
DEBUG: .../IO/Socket/SSL.pm:2458: ok=1 cert=58095216
DEBUG: .../IO/Socket/SSL.pm:1570: scheme=www cert=58095216
DEBUG: .../IO/Socket/SSL.pm:1580: identity=ssl.ibanrechner.de cn=ssl.ibanrechner.de alt=2 ssl.ibanrechner.de 2 bak1.iban-bic.com 2 sepatools.eu
DEBUG: .../IO/Socket/SSL.pm:667: Net::SSLeay::connect -> -1
DEBUG: .../IO/Socket/SSL.pm:677: ssl handshake in progress
DEBUG: .../IO/Socket/SSL.pm:687: waiting for fd to become ready: SSL wants a read first
DEBUG: .../IO/Socket/SSL.pm:707: socket ready, retrying connect
DEBUG: .../IO/Socket/SSL.pm:667: Net::SSLeay::connect -> 1
DEBUG: .../IO/Socket/SSL.pm:722: ssl handshake done
DEBUG: .../IO/Socket/SSL.pm:2635: free ctx 49599632 open=49599632
DEBUG: .../IO/Socket/SSL.pm:2640: free ctx 49599632 callback
DEBUG: .../IO/Socket/SSL.pm:2647: OK free ctx 49599632
Service description 'https://ssl.ibanrechner.de/soap/?wsdl' can't be loaded: 500 Status read failed: Ein nicht blockierender Socketvorgang konnte nicht sofort ausgeführt werden.
Diese Fehlermeldung kommt jetzt bei allen drei Scripten. Ich bin da, wie gesagt, nicht eingestiegen, aber vielleicht bringt Dich diese Meldung ja weiter.